Industrial Effluent Treatment

Application-specific microbial formulations for industries with complex wastewater characteristics

Every industry produces a different effluent — food processing loads of fats and starch, textile streams with dyes and salts, chemical and pharmaceutical flows with complex organics. A generic biological program cannot handle this variety reliably.

Our industrial effluent treatment programs pair application-specific BIOCO microbial formulations with a structured dosing and monitoring plan — stabilising the biological stage against shock loads, degrading complex pollutants and keeping outlet parameters consistently within norms.
